Ver Mensaje Individual
  #2  
Antiguo 25-04-2017
Avatar de ecfisa
ecfisa ecfisa is offline
Moderador
 
Registrado: dic 2005
Ubicación: Tres Arroyos, Argentina
Posts: 10.508
Reputación: 36
ec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to behold
Hola.

Hice la prueba y este código asigna correctamente todos los permisos al usuario enviado:
Código PHP:
void __fastcall TForm1::grantAllpriv( const AnsiString userName )
{
  
TIBStoredProc *sp = (TIBStoredProc*)(IBStoredProc1);

  
sp->Database       IBDatabase1;
  
sp->StoredProcName "SP_GRANT_ALL_TO";
  
sp->Params->Clear();
  
sp->Params->CreateParam(ftString"TCNOMBREUSUARIO"ptInput);
  
sp->Params->ParamByName("TCNOMBREUSUARIO")->AsString userName;
  
sp->ExecProc();

  
sp->Transaction->CommitRetaining();

Saludos
__________________
Daniel Didriksen

Guía de estilo - Uso de las etiquetas - La otra guía de estilo ....
Responder Con Cita